    Bayview Black History Month Bike Ride 2026

    Join us in supporting Black history, local businesses, and safe biking in our community! 🚲

    Livable City and San Francisco Bicycle Coalition are partnering for a special Black History Month ride through San Francisco.

    Between 150–200 riders will tour significant Black history sites throughout the city, concluding on 3rd Street to patronize local Black-owned businesses. We are providing Bike Valet services and need volunteers to help make it a success.

    Event Details:

    Date: Saturday, February 28, 2026

    Ride Start: 9:00 AM at the Martin Luther King Jr. Memorial

    Ride End: Between 1:00–1:30 PM on 3rd Street (Bayview)

    Volunteer Shifts

    SHIFT #1 - Set-Up (>6 volunteers needed)

    Setting Up 17-18 barricades for bike valet at each site.

    🕙 10:00 AM – 1:00 PM

    3 - volunteers at: Ruth Williams Bayview Opera House (4705 3rd Street)

    3 - volunteers at: Smoke Soul Kitchen (4618 3rd St, San Francisco, CA 94124)

    SHIFT #2 - Breakdown (>3 volunteers needed)

    Breakdown and Staging Street Closure Equipment for pick up: 17-18 barricades for bike valet at each site.

    🕓 4:00 PM – 5:00 PM

    3 - volunteers at: Ruth Williams Bayview Opera House (4705 3rd Street)

    3 - volunteers at: Smoke Soul Kitchen (4618 3rd St, San Francisco, CA 94124)

    • Wear closed-toe shoes
    • Comfortable clothing
    • Stay hydrated; bring a refillable water bottle

    Must be able to lift up to 50 lbs.
